Output dea14b9385d923f7332ef24ffbe94e9bcb1cd9e5f86e7fa38485848a09df00a5:6

value
12586389
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c80e5676717379a0cd4f5ac0165873305d6accb9 OP_EQUAL
address
3KvpF7Z7Z53k8ReMgbMy9vKh5pHwXjFNpS
transaction
dea14b9385d923f7332ef24ffbe94e9bcb1cd9e5f86e7fa38485848a09df00a5
confirmations
379862
spent
true